§ 4-12-8-2 — Establishment and purpose of account; administration

Indiana·Art. 12 APPROPRIATIONS MANAGEMENT·Ch. 8 Indiana Prescription Drug Account
(a)The Indiana prescription drug account is established within the Indiana tobacco master settlement agreement fund for the purpose of providing access to needed prescription drugs to ensure the health and welfare of Indiana’s low-income senior citizens. The account consists of:
(1)amounts to be distributed to the account from the Indiana tobacco master settlement agreement fund;
(2)appropriations to the account from other sources;
(3)rebates:
(A)required under 42 U.S.C. 1396r-8(a) for a Medicaid waiver under which a prescription drug program is established or implemented; or
(B)voluntarily negotiated under a prescription drug program that is established or implemented; to provide access to prescription drugs for low income senior citizens; and
